The Clock at the Station: Where Time Stops

About The Book

<p>At midnight the station clock strikes twelve&mdash;and then it forms a loop.</p><p>What if time itself could pause at a forgotten railway station? What if the lives of strangers rushing past in the dark were secretly intertwined in ways they could never imagine?</p><p>The Clock at the Station: Where Time Stops is the haunting first book of The Midnight Trilogy a literary mystery where past present and future fold into each other.</p><p>In this circular tale thirty characters pass through the same station each carrying secrets regrets and dreams. A grieving mother searching for closure. A young lover waiting for a train that never comes. A wanderer running from the shadows of his past. A teacher who knows more than he reveals. None of them realize they are pieces of a larger puzzle connected by the silent clock and the endless tracks.</p><p>As stories weave and overlap emotions bleed from one character to the next. Each chapter is a mirror reflecting loss longing and the fragile beauty of human connection. And when the loop completes the reader will return to where it all began&mdash;only to discover that nothing and no one is the same.</p><p>Mysterious poetic and unforgettable The Clock at the Station invites readers into a world where time halts memories linger and destiny waits at midnight.</p>
